1. Enhanced Collaboration Across Teams

One of the primary reasons companies use online collaborative productivity software is to enhance collaboration among team members. In a world where remote work is becoming the norm, these tools allow employees to work together in real-time, regardless of their physical location. Whether it’s a team spread across different time zones or a group of freelancers working on a project, collaborative software ensures that everyone is on the same page.

Real-Time Communication

Tools like Slack, Microsoft Teams, and Zoom provide platforms for real-time communication. Employees can chat, share files, and even hold video conferences, all within the same application. This eliminates the need for lengthy email threads and ensures that communication is swift and efficient.

Shared Workspaces

Platforms like Google Workspace and Trello offer shared workspaces where team members can collaborate on documents, spreadsheets, and project boards. This allows for simultaneous editing, version control, and easy access to shared resources, making teamwork more efficient and reducing the risk of miscommunication.

2. Improved Project Management

Another significant advantage of online collaborative productivity software is its ability to improve project management. These tools provide a centralized platform where project managers can assign tasks, track progress, and monitor deadlines.

Task Assignment and Tracking

Tools like Asana and Monday.com allow managers to assign tasks to team members, set deadlines, and track progress in real-time. This ensures that everyone knows what they need to do and when it needs to be done, reducing the likelihood of tasks falling through the cracks.

Gantt Charts and Timelines

Many collaborative tools offer Gantt charts and timelines, which provide a visual representation of project progress. This helps managers identify potential bottlenecks and allocate resources more effectively, ensuring that projects are completed on time and within budget.

3. Increased Flexibility and Remote Work Capabilities

The rise of remote work has made online collaborative productivity software indispensable for many companies. These tools enable employees to work from anywhere, at any time, without sacrificing productivity or collaboration.

Cloud-Based Access

Most collaborative software is cloud-based, meaning that employees can access their work from any device with an internet connection. This flexibility allows for a better work-life balance and can lead to increased job satisfaction and employee retention.

Mobile Applications

Many collaborative tools offer mobile applications, allowing employees to stay connected and productive even when they’re on the go. Whether it’s responding to a message on Slack or updating a task in Trello, mobile apps ensure that work doesn’t have to stop just because you’re away from your desk.

4. Cost-Effectiveness

Implementing online collaborative productivity software can also be a cost-effective solution for companies. These tools often eliminate the need for expensive hardware and software installations, as well as reduce the costs associated with travel and in-person meetings.

Reduced IT Costs

Cloud-based software typically requires less IT infrastructure and maintenance, reducing the burden on IT departments. Additionally, many collaborative tools offer subscription-based pricing models, allowing companies to scale their usage up or down based on their needs.

Lower Travel Expenses

With the ability to hold virtual meetings and collaborate online, companies can significantly reduce their travel expenses. This is particularly beneficial for businesses with teams spread across different regions or countries.

5. Enhanced Security and Data Protection

In an era where data breaches and cyberattacks are on the rise, security is a top priority for companies. Online collaborative productivity software often comes with robust security features that protect sensitive information and ensure compliance with data protection regulations.

Encryption and Access Controls

Many collaborative tools offer end-to-end encryption and advanced access controls, ensuring that only authorized users can access sensitive data. This helps prevent unauthorized access and data breaches, giving companies peace of mind.

Compliance with Regulations

Collaborative software providers often ensure that their tools comply with industry-specific regulations, such as GDPR or HIPAA. This helps companies avoid costly fines and legal issues related to data protection.

8. Integration with Other Tools

Another advantage of online collaborative productivity software is its ability to integrate with other tools and applications. This creates a seamless workflow and eliminates the need for employees to switch between multiple platforms.

Third-Party Integrations

Many collaborative tools offer integrations with popular third-party applications, such as CRM systems, marketing automation tools, and accounting software. This allows for a more streamlined workflow and ensures that all relevant data is easily accessible.

API Access

Some collaborative tools provide API access, allowing companies to develop custom integrations and automate workflows. This can save time and reduce the risk of errors, leading to increased efficiency.

9. Data Analytics and Reporting

Online collaborative productivity software often includes data analytics and reporting features that provide valuable insights into team performance and project progress.

Performance Metrics

Tools like Asana and Trello offer performance metrics that allow managers to track individual and team performance. This helps identify areas for improvement and ensures that employees are meeting their goals.

Project Reporting

Collaborative software often includes project reporting features that provide detailed insights into project progress, resource allocation, and budget tracking. This helps managers make informed decisions and ensures that projects stay on track.
